What are the benefits of knowing medical terminology?

The purpose of medical terminology is to create a standardised language for medical professionals. This language helps medical staff communicate more efficiently and makes documentation easier.

What is called antibiotic?

Antibiotics are medicines that help stop infections caused by bacteria. They do this by killing the bacteria or by keeping them from copying themselves or reproducing. The word antibiotic means “against life.” Any drug that kills germs in your body is technically an antibiotic.

What two languages do medical terminology originate from?

Although medical terms have been drawn from many languages, a large majority are from Greek and Latin.

What is prefix and example?

A prefix is an affix which is placed before the stem of a word. Adding it to the beginning of one word changes it into another word. For example, when the prefix un- is added to the word happy, it creates the word unhappy. Prefixes, like all other affixes, are usually bound morphemes.

What are suffix words?

A suffix is a letter or group of letters added to the end of a word. Suffixes are commonly used to show the part of speech of a word. For example, adding “ion” to the verb “act” gives us “action,” the noun form of the word. Suffixes also tell us the verb tense of words or whether the words are plural or singular.

What is the example of suffix?

A suffix is a letter or group of letters, for example ‘-ly’ or ‘-ness’, which is added to the end of a word in order to form a different word, often of a different word class. For example, the suffix ‘-ly’ is added to ‘quick’ to form ‘quickly’.

What is a prefix before your name?

These can be titles prefixing a person’s name, e.g.: Mr, Mrs, Miss, Ms, Mx, Sir, Dr, Lady or Lord, or titles or positions that can appear as a form of address without the person’s name, as in Mr President, General, Captain, Father, Doctor or Earl.

What are the five suffixes?

Adjective Suffixes

  • -able, -ible. Meaning: capable of being.
  • -al. Meaning: pertaining to.
  • -ant. Meaning: inclined to or tending to.
  • -ary. Meaning: of or relating to.
  • -ful. Meaning: full of or notable of.
  • -ic. Meaning: relating to.
  • -ious, -ous. Meaning: having qualities of.
  • -ive. Meaning: quality or nature of.
